Piracy websites do not make money from movie tickets; they profit from malicious ad networks. Clicking on a download link for Fast and Furious 9 on Tamilyogi often triggers a chain of redirects. These can automatically download malware, spyware, or ransomware onto your smartphone or computer, compromising your personal data, passwords, and banking information. 2. F9 was shot in a 2.39:1 aspect ratio. On Tamilyogi, that widescreen epic is often cropped, stretched, or flipped to fit a 4:3 or 16:9 window. You lose the peripheral action—the explosion on the left side of the screen? Gone. The car flying in from the right? You only see the bumper.
